Does anyone know how to find the highlights that you make in e-sword HD? When making a highlight it offers a spectrum of colors and it also has a tab for "remove highlights" and "view all highlights." But the "view all highlights" is greyed out and doesn't work. I would like to able to see/find all my highlights in an easy way. I highlight a lot in the commentary section and my desire is to copy those highlights so I can have easy access to them for message prep. Right now, if I have highlighted in multiple commentaries, there's no easy way to find those highlights. Even if it was like Kindle where you just click on highlights and they are all there.

I asked the question to Rick and the "view all highlights" feature only works in the bible/scripture section. You have to hold down the verse reference and then highlight and then view all highlights. He suggested using the bookmark feature for the commentaries. Somewhat helpful, but doesn't solve my problem of having to copy my highlights. My best solution for now is to use the Share feature and send them to an Evernote notebook that I have entitled E-Sword Highlights, then I have them all in one place and then copy them into Scrivener...which is what I use for message preperation and other writing projects.
